Today's Betting Overview - Jets @ Packers

The Jets take on the Packers on Sunday, October 16th at Lambeau Field, Green Bay. RotoBaller provides free handicapping picks and odds for all NFL games throughout the 2022 season.

  • Matchup: New York Jets (3-2) vs. Green Bay Packers (3-2)
  • Date: Sunday, October 16th, 2022
  • Time: 1:00 PM ET
  • Venue: Lambeau Field

New York Jets - NFL Betting Analysis

Looking back to last week, the Jets defeated the Miami Dolphins by a score of 40-17. In addition to winning the game, the Jets picked up an ATS win as they were 3.0-point underdogs. The teams combined for a total of 57 points, which surpassed the over-under betting line of 46. Despite being the 3.0-point underdogs heading into the game, the Jets held a 2 point lead heading into the 4th quarter. Through 5 games, the Jets have an ATS record of 3-2. So far, they have an over-under record of 3-2. This week's betting total of 46.0 is slightly higher than the line in their previous games.

Heading into this week's matchup, the Jets offense is averaging 23.2 points per game, placing them 11th in the NFL. Even though they have a tough matchup against the league's 11th-ranked defense, look for New York to continue their strong offensive play. In the passing attack, the Jets head into the game averaging 259 yards per game through the air. This week, they are facing off against a secondary that is ranked 24th in passer rating allowed. However, our projections show that New York could still be in line for a below-average performance through the air. On the ground, our projections show that the Jets' offense will have its problems. Even though they have a decent matchup against Green Bay, look for New York to come up with fewer rush yards than their season average of 97.0.

 

Green Bay Packers - NFL Betting Analysis

Heading into week 5, the Green Bay Packers are looking to bounce back from a loss to the Giants by a score of 27-22, giving them a loss against a NFC opponent. With the loss, Green Bay failed to cover the spread, as they had a -9.5 advantage on the spread. With their combined 42 points, the two teams exceeded the betting over-under number of 42. This was a difficult loss for Green Bay, as they held 7 point lead heading into the 4th quarter. Through 5 games, the Packers have an ATS record of 2-3. So far, they have an over-under record of 2-3. This week's betting total of 46.0 is slightly higher than the line in their previous games.

Heading into this week's matchup, the Packers' offense is averaging 19.4 points per game, placing them 22nd in the NFL. Look for the team to put together a strong offensive performance vs a Jets defense giving up 23.6 points per game. This week, look for the Packers to struggle in the passing game, as not only have they struggled to move the ball through the air, but they are facing a secondary ranked 10th in passer rating allowed. On the ground, the Packers should be in line for a good performance, as they are one of the better rushing team's in the league and are facing a defense that has its problem stopping the run.

 

Today's NFL Betting Pick - Jets vs. Packers

New York comes into the game looking to continue their recent success over New York, as they have a record of 3-2. The over-under record in these games sits at 4-1, with the average scoring total coming in at 50.6 points. Last year, the Jets and Packers did not play each other.

When looking at how the teams have performed vs the spread, neither unit has a leg up, each covering 2 times. On average, the Jets have averaged 28.4 points per game in the past 5 head-to-head matchups, compared to Green Bay at 22.2.

Through their last 3 games, the Jets have a record of 2-1. In these games, they have a 2-1 record vs the spread and an over-under mark of 2-1.

New York has played well in their previous 3 road games, going 2-1 straight up. In this stretch, they averaged 21.67 points per game while allowing 25.67. The team also performed well vs the spread at 2-1.

Green Bay has put together a record of 2-1 over their past 3 games. In addition, their ATS record over this stretch is 1-2 while posting a 2-1 over-under mark.

When looking at their past 3 home matchups, Green Bay has an ATS record of 1-2 while averaging 25.33 per game. The team went 2-1 overall in these games.

Recommended ATS Betting Pick: Packers -7.0

Recommended OU Betting Pick: Over 46.0
